SYNOPSIS
The old question: what do lesbians do out of bed? TV channels commission bed/bar-hopping docs, but this film about an annual lesbian fair in a London back garden reveals subversive chutneys and prizewinning pickles from Grandmother’s recipes. Proof lesbians have irony and ironing skills: Women’s Institute costumes; butches and femmes alike rustling up controversial desserts, Goddess-themed breads and age-appropriate Morris-dancing.
